CVE-2022-44073
PHP vulnerability analysis and mitigation

Overview

Zenario CMS 9.3.57186 is vulnerable to Cross Site Scripting (XSS) via SVG files in the Users & Contacts module. This vulnerability was discovered in October 2022 and affects the image upload functionality of the system (CISA Bulletin).

Technical details

The vulnerability exists in the image upload functionality within the Users & Contacts module. When uploading SVG files through the image upload feature, the system fails to properly validate or sanitize the SVG content, allowing for the execution of malicious JavaScript code (GitHub Issue). The vulnerability has been assigned a CVSS score of 5.4, indicating a medium severity level (CISA Bulletin).

Impact

When successfully exploited, this v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ary JavaScript code in the context of other users' browsers who view the malicious SVG file. This can lead to session hijacking, data theft, or other client-side attacks (GitHub Issue).
